In one of television's first adult Westerns, the famous marshal puts his life on the line to maintain order, first in Dodge City, Kan., then in Tombstone, Ariz.
Starring: Damian O'Flynn, Don Haggerty, Douglas Fowley, Hugh O'Brian, James Seay, Mason Alan Dinehart, Morgan Woodward, Paul Brinegar, Ralph Sanford, Randy Stuart, Rico Alaniz, Sam Flint, Stacy Harris, Trevor Bardette, William Tannen
Original Air Date: Sep 6, 1955

Gunsmoke

Marshal Matt Dillon (then-newcomer James Arness) tries to prevent lawlessness from overtaking Dodge City, Kan. Helping to keep him grounded are saloon proprietor Miss Kitty Russell and Doc Adams. The television series grew out of the long-running radio serial of the same name, although for a short time they were both on the airwaves.
